    Area 51 is a highly classified United States Air Force facility located in the southern part of Nevada, USA. Known for its secrecy, it is rumored to be the site of experimental aircraft testing and other classified research. The area is heavily guarded and access is strictly restricted to authorized personnel only.

  • Extraterrestrial Highway

    Located near Area 51, the Extraterrestrial Highway is a 98-mile stretch of State Route 375, known for its association with UFOs and alleged extraterrestrial activities. Visitors can enjoy scenic desert views and have the opportunity to spot various unidentified flying objects along the way.
  • Rachel, Nevada

    Situated near Area 51, Rachel is a small town known as the 'UFO Capital of the World.' Visitors can explore the Little A'Le'Inn, a quirky alien-themed motel and restaurant, where they can learn about Area 51 and share stories with like-minded UFO enthusiasts.
  • Groom Lake

    Groom Lake is a dry salt lake located within the boundaries of Area 51. While access to the lake itself is restricted, visitors can hike up nearby Tikaboo Peak or other vantage points to get a distant glimpse of this secretive lake surrounded by desert landscape.
